Important Parts of the Dodge Ram 3500
Below is an in-depth introduction of a few of the essential components that contribute to the total functionality of the Dodge Ram 3500.
| Part | Function | Common Issues |
|---|---|---|
| Engine | The heart of the car; supplies power and torque. | Oil leakages, getting too hot, bad efficiency |
| Transmission | Transfers engine power to the wheels; essential for equipment changes. | Slipping gears, fluid leaks, sound |
| Suspension | Supports the weight of the truck and soaks up shocks from the roadway. | Use and tear, positioning concerns |
| Brakes | Important for automobile security; permits for stopping. | Used pads, rotor problems |
| Exhaust System | Directs exhaust gases away; necessary for efficiency and emissions control. | Deterioration, leaks |
| Radiator | Cools the engine by flowing coolant. | Leakages, obstructions |
| Fuel System | Materials clean fuel to the engine. | Blockages, pump failure |
| Electrical System | Powers the vehicle's electronic components and systems. | Battery concerns, wiring problems |
Engine Parts
The engine is perhaps the most important element of any vehicle, and the Ram 3500 is no exception. Over the years, it has actually seen significant enhancements in performance and power. Key engine parts consist of:
- Oil Filters: Crucial for keeping tidy oil blood circulation.
- Fuel Injectors: Ensure optimum fuel atomization for better combustion.
- Pistons and Rings: Integral for compression and power generation.
Transmission Parts
The Dodge Ram 3500 features several transmission alternatives, making it versatile for numerous tasks. Notable transmission components include:
- Clutch Kits: Vital for manual transmissions to enable smooth equipment shifts.
- Transmission Filters: Help maintain fluid cleanliness and prevent wear.
- Torque Converters: Essential for automated transmissions, supplying smooth velocity.
Suspension and Steering
A robust suspension system is critical for dealing with heavy loads and offering a smooth trip. Fundamental parts include:
- Shock Absorbers: Help to stabilize the truck's trip quality.
- Leaf Springs: Provide load-bearing assistance and stability.
- Ball Joints: Allow for smooth steering and suspension movement.
Picking the Right Parts
When picking parts for your Dodge Ram 3500, think about the following:
- OEM vs. Aftermarket: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) parts are created particularly for your car, whereas aftermarket parts might offer options that fit or boost functionality.
- Quality Certification: Look for parts with accreditations that reflect their performance and dependability.
- Service Warranty and Return Policy: Ensure that the parts include a warranty and a beneficial return policy to protect your investment.
- Compatibility: Always validate the parts are compatible with your specific design year and engine type.
